The Maemo platform is made up of Linux and open source software extensively distributed in the most popular Linux distributions. At its core is Hildon application framework, which is based on GNOME technology. GNOME provides an intuitive and attractive PC desktop for Linux-based end users and a powerful framework for creating applications that integrate into the rest of the PC desktop. Maemo adapts this widely deployed desktop technology to portable devices with extensions and modifications to develop a user interface framework best suited for portable device category devices. The development platform is aimed at open source developers and innovation houses that develop applications and new technologies for portable devices connected to the Internet based on Linux.
